Social Media Marketing Ideas For Plumbing Businesses That Actually Bring Calls
Here is the simple truth. Around 90 percent of small businesses use social media in their marketing, and 78 percent of shoppers research social media before making a purchase. If your plumbing company is not showing up with helpful content, you are invisible when people are deciding who to call.
The good news is that plumbers do not need dancing videos or viral memes. You need trust, proof, and a clear path to contact you. Let us walk through a step by step plan.
Choose The Platforms Where Plumbing Customers Actually Hang Out
You do not need every platform on earth. Focus on where local homeowners and property managers already spend their time.
For most plumbing businesses, start with:
Facebook for local community groups, reviews, and service posts
Instagram for before and after visuals and short reels
YouTube for “how to” videos and local authority building
Optional: TikTok for quick fixes and fun personality clips if you enjoy video
Over 70 percent of Facebook users visit local business pages at least once a week, which makes a consistent presence there a must for plumbers.

Content Ideas That Turn Followers Into Future Plumbing Customers
Most plumbers get stuck on “what do I even post?” Here are social media marketing ideas for plumbing businesses that work in the real world.
1. Before And After Repair Stories
Share a quick story with three images or clips:
The ugly problem
The repair in progress
The final clean result
Add a simple caption such as “Sunday night leak. Monday morning fix. If your ceiling looks like photo one, call us before it turns into photo zero.”
This makes your skills visible and builds trust quickly.
2. Short “Help First” Videos
People love quick fixes. Record 30 to 60 second videos like:
“How to safely shut your main water off in an emergency”
“When to call a pro instead of using drain chemicals”
“3 signs your water heater is about to fail”

3. “Day In The Life” And Team Personality Posts
Homeowners want to know who is coming into their house. Share:
A tech grabbing coffee before an early water heater install
Celebrating a team member’s work anniversary
A short intro video from each technician
This reduces fear, builds familiarity, and lifts your conversion rate when someone finally needs a plumber.
Use Reviews, Referrals, And Local Proof On Social
Around 71 percent of consumers read online reviews when researching local businesses, and online reviews influence a big share of buying decisions. That means your happy customers are your best marketing team.
Practical ideas:
Take a screenshot of a new five star Google review and post it with a thank you caption
Ask customers if you can take a quick selfie with them in front of the fixed issue
Run a simple referral campaign such as “Refer a friend who books a job this month and you both get a discount on your next service”

Posting Schedule And Simple Social Media System For Plumbers
You do not need to post 10 times per day. You do need consistency.
Studies show that the best engagement often happens on weekdays during business hours, with many brands seeing strong results around late mornings and early afternoons.
A realistic plumber schedule:
3 posts per week on Facebook
1 before or after story
1 review or testimonial
1 helpful tip or “day in the life”
2 posts per week on Instagram
Short reel of a job
Carousel of photos with a simple story
1 video per week on YouTube
A “how to” or local homeowner education video
Batch content on one day each week and schedule everything in advance so you are not scrambling between calls.
Boosting Results With Paid Social And Smart Funnels
Organic posts build trust. Smart plumbers then amplify what is working.
Social media ads can be extremely efficient. Businesses that invest in social media ads see an average return of over five dollars for every one dollar spent. For plumbing companies, that can look like:
A Facebook campaign targeting homeowners in your service area with a “Same Day Emergency Plumbing” offer
Retargeting ads that show to anyone who has visited your website in the last 30 days
A lead form ad for “Free water heater check” or “$50 off any leak repair”

Turn Your Best Social Posts Into Website Content
Do not let your best social content disappear into the feed. Turn it into long form posts on your site to help with SEO.
For example:
A “Top 7 signs you need a new water heater” reel becomes a full blog post
A “things your plumber wishes you knew before you flush” post becomes a fun listicle
